We are currently recruiting for a 6-month fixed term, full time position with a competitive pay and benefits package including a salary of £30,997 per year. Reporting to the team leader, this role is responsible for the health, safety and compliance of our Haven Housing Schemes to ensure that tenants can live safely and independently.

Collaborating with internal stakeholders, the role is responsible for ensuring services are facilitated effectively through identifying issues and raising concerns. Work closely with the tenants and external partners to ensure that any safeguarding measures are identified, address any low level or basic risk, and escalating to the appropriate stakeholders.

How to prepare for a job interview at Tai Tarian Ltd

Understanding the Role of Empathy

In social work, understanding and demonstrating empathy is key. Be prepared to share personal experiences or scenarios where you effectively showed compassion and support. This helps show that you genuinely care about the well-being of others, which is crucial in social work.

Demonstrating Knowledge of Frameworks

Familiarise yourself with the frameworks and models used in social work, such as the Strengths-Based Approach or the Ecological Perspective. Be ready to discuss how these frameworks apply to your work, especially if you can tie them into real-world examples or case studies you've encountered.

Showcasing Your Multi-Disciplinary Skills

In a full-time social work role, you'll often collaborate with healthcare professionals, educators, and law enforcement. Be prepared to describe your teamwork experiences and how you've effectively communicated with other disciplines to achieve the best outcomes for clients.

Preparing for Scenario-Based Questions

Expect questions that put you in hypothetical social work situations, such as dealing with a crisis or managing a complex case. Think through your thought process for these scenarios beforehand, considering how you'd assess the situation and what steps you'd take, as this demonstrates your critical thinking and problem-solving abilities.
